Ticket: Staticforge vault locked mid-rebuild. While reviewing the incremental rebuild pipeline for Larkmoor Docs, the deploy job triggered three failed unseals and the vault auto-locked, blocking asset manifests. Please verify the diff doesn't retry unseal in a loop before approving. To reproduce locally, unlock the staging vault with the passphrase below.

recovery phrase for fahif-hadup: sorix-holael

## Bulk Edits in the Tallygrid Admin Table

Quick heads-up for release managers: bulk edits in Tallygrid are gated behind the release-freeze flag. During a freeze, the Bulk Actions menu is read-only on purpose — don't file a bug. Edits outside a freeze apply within a minute and are logged per batch. Questions or freeze exceptions go to the Tallygrid owners.

escalation mailbox, bafog-fafog: ulador@paliqlabs.internal

ALERT: AgriLink gateway heartbeat loss. The Harrowfield telemetry gateway stops reporting when more than 40 combines push CAN-bus frames simultaneously. Symptoms: flatlined ingest graph, stale soil-moisture readings on the Plotwise dashboard. Do not restart the gateway blind — drain the buffer queue first or you lose unsynced field data. Check uplink modem status, then queue depth, then firmware version. Full triage steps and escalation order are on the internal wiki page below.

wiki page, tahaf-tajog: https://jira.ordindyn.corp/pipeline

Hi dispatch,

Records team here. The full blueprint set for the Thornbury Annex building permit is rolled, tubed, and waiting at the records counter — three tubes, clearly marked. The planning office at Caldwell Hall needs them stamped by end of day, so an afternoon run would be ideal. Please make sure the tubes stay dry; the forecast looks grim and these are the originals, not copies. We've logged them out already on our side. The courier handover should follow the confidential instruction below.

courier memo of yahif-faweg: the quenael tamius courier leaves the prawyn jorix kaswyn istox silmir brieth zormir fenvan ledger at gate 3145 under passcode 231062